What problem does it solve?

UX researchers need a streamlined workflow to plan, run, and synthesize insights from interviews, reducing manual overhead and bias.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Generate semi-structured interview guides from research questions and project context
  • Process interview transcripts (TXT, PDF, DOCX, MD) — extract nuggets, tags, and themes
  • Identify follow-up questions and research gaps
  • Synthesize findings across multiple interviews with cross-cutting themes
  • Calculate intercoder reliability when multiple coders are involved
